Wayve and Uber Launch UK's First Supervised Robotaxi Service in London

Wayve, a British embodied artificial intelligence company, has announced a partnership with Uber to launch the UK's first supervised robotaxi service in London. This marks Wayve's first commercial deployment, signaling the company's transition from technology research and development to actual operational service.

The service operates in a supervised model, with safety operators or remote monitoring personnel present during vehicle operation to ensure safety. This collaboration represents a concrete case of the robotaxi industry moving from technology validation toward scaled commercial operations.
